Iga Sviontek played in the Wimbledon quarterfinals with Belinda Bencic. The Polka never played in this phase of this struggle. The most that she has passed is the 4th round in 2021 at this Grand Slam tournament.
On Sunday 9 July, Iga Swiatek faced another challenge at this year’s Wimbledon. So far, the first racket of the world is doing very well in this Grand Slam tournament. In her previous matches, the Pole easily defeated Lin Zhu 2:0 (6:3, 6:1), and then defeated Sarah Sorribes Tormo (6:2, 6:0) without losing a set. In the 1/16 tournament, Iga Swiatek defeated Petra Martic.

In the 4th round, the first rocket of the world met with Belinda Bencic, who copes well with rivals of a higher rank. From the very beginning, both chess players played very evenly, but with a slight hint of Iga Sviontek, who could break her opponent twice at the beginning of the match, but was close to dotting all the i’s.
With the score at 2:2, Iga Sviontek requested a break for treatment due to the discomfort she felt in her shoes. The tennis player’s shoes must have rubbed her a little, which is what happened. Fortunately, after returning to the game, the game of the first racket of the world was the same as before. A moment later she had another break point, but unfortunately she missed it again.

The first set was fierce until the end, and with the score 5:4, Iga Sviontek managed to take the lead, but again she could not finish this game positively. There were six in total. There were no breaks in twelve games, so the fate of the game was to be decided by a tie-break.
As a result, the Swiss kept her cool, playing this tie-break almost flawlessly. Bencic won 6-1, but Iga Sviontek returned to the game for a short time. As a result, she lost the game 4:7.

Luckily, Iga Sviontek got up after the end of the previous game. Belinda Bencic started the second set with errors, giving Iga Sviontek another chance to win when her opponent served. This time, the first racket of the world did not lead to an advantage and, with an excellent return, broke the opponent and the curse of six break points from the first set.
Unfortunately, with the score 3:2, Bencic made up for lost time and again defeated Iga Sviontek. This set was very even to the end. Unfortunately, in the twelfth game, the Swiss had the first match points, which the first racket of the world successfully defended and led to another tie-break, in which she won 7:2.

The third set was just as intense as the previous ones, although fatigue was evident on both sides. This was reflected in the percentage of first passes played, which increasingly turned out to be inaccurate. As the game progressed, Belinda Bencic began to feel discomfort in her bandaged biceps, which Iga Sviontek took advantage of, who defeated the Swiss already with the score 2:1.
In that set, the first racket of the world eventually won with a score of 6:3 and reached the quarterfinals of Wimbledon, which was her best result in her career. In the semi-finals, she will meet the winner of the pair Victoria Azarenka - Elina Svitolon.
